Solihull est une ville dans les Midlands de l'Ouest en Angleterre avec une population de 94 753 habitants . Elle fait partie de la conurbation des Midlands de l'Ouest avec les villes de Birmingham, Wolverhampton et les villes du Black Country . Solihull est située au sud-est de Birmingham. C'est la plus grande ville et le chef-lieu d'un secteur nommé district métropolitain de Solihull. Les habitants de Solihull sont appelés : Sihillians.

The Metropolitan Borough of Solihull is a metropolitan borough of the West Midlands, in west-central England. It is named after its largest town, Solihull, from which Solihull Metropolitan Borough Council is based. For Eurostat purposes it is a NUTS 3 region and is one of seven boroughs or unitary districts that comprise the "West Midlands" NUTS 2 region. Much of the large residential population in the north of the borough centres on the communities of Castle Bromwich, Chelmsley Wood, Fordbridge, Kingshurst, Marston Green and Smith's Wood. In the south are the town of Solihull, its sub-town of Shirley and the large villages of Knowle, Dorridge, Meriden and Balsall Common. Since 2011, Solihull has formed part of the Greater Birmingham & Solihull Local Enterprise Partnership along with neighbouring authorities Birmingham, Bromsgrove, Cannock Chase, East Staffordshire, Lichfield, Redditch, Tamworth and Wyre Forest.
